  • What really happened inside the Haunted Fairbanks House of Sicily Island, Louisiana?

    In this episode of True Hauntings, we investigate the disturbing story of the Fairbanks House, a historic Louisiana home now known for paranormal activity, ghost investigations, strange noises, shadow figures, alleged EVPs, and the chilling legend of “Henrietta’s Closet.”

    The story centres on Henrietta Fairbanks, a young woman said to have suffered from epilepsy and seizures before her early death in 1922. Over time, her real life appears to have been reshaped into something darker: a tale of confinement, a haunted closet, and a ghost story that has become part of the house’s modern paranormal reputation.

    But is the Fairbanks House truly haunted?

    Or has Henrietta’s story been transformed by rumour, psychic claims, paranormal investigators, ghost-hunting television, YouTube investigations, and the business of haunted tourism?

    Anne and Renata examine the history, the reported paranormal phenomena, the claims connected to The Dead Files episode “Bent on Revenge: Sicily Island, LA,” and the modern ghost stories surrounding the Haunted Fairbanks House. We look at the witness accounts, the investigation reports, the contradictions, and the way a tragic family story may have evolved into one of Louisiana’s most talked-about haunted house legends.

    This is not just a ghost story. It is a case about illness, grief, folklore, paranormal storytelling, and what can happen when the life of a real woman becomes the centrepiece of a haunting.

  • In this episode of True Hauntings Podcast, we investigate the strange and unsettling case of The Cideville Poltergeist, one of France’s most unusual 19th-century paranormal mysteries.

    In 1850, at a quiet presbytery in Cideville, Normandy, two boys studying under Curé Jean Tinel became the centre of a terrifying series of unexplained events: mysterious knocks in the walls, flying objects, moving furniture, musical raps, strange voices, and claims of a dark figure haunting the house.

    But this was no ordinary ghost story.

    The haunting soon turned into a legal battle when local shepherd Félix Thorel was accused of being connected to the disturbances through sorcery. Thorel denied the claims and sued the priest for defamation, turning the Cideville Poltergeist into a rare paranormal case that ended up in court.

    Was this a genuine poltergeist haunting? Were the boys responsible for the activity? Was Thorel a sorcerer, a scapegoat, or simply the man the village chose to blame? And how did fear, religion, gossip, and reputation turn strange knocks in a priest’s house into one of France’s most fascinating haunted history cases?

  • What happens when a young girl begins to suffer attacks
 from something no one can see?

    In 1925, 11-year-old Elenore Zugun became the centre of one of the most disturbing poltergeist cases ever recorded. Witnesses claimed objects moved on their own, unseen forces struck her, and most chilling of all
 bite marks appeared on her body while people watched.

    Was this a case of possession?

    A genuine poltergeist?

    Or something far more human—and far more complex?

    Investigated by neurologists, observed by aristocrats, and later examined by famed paranormal researcher Harry Price, the Zugun case sits at the crossroads of belief and skepticism. Even today, it refuses to give us a clear answer.

    In this episode of True Hauntings, we follow Elenore’s story from a small Romanian village to the laboratories of Vienna and London
 uncovering the witnesses, the evidence, and the theories that still divide opinion nearly a century later.

  • Tucked into the shadow of St Giles’ Cathedral, on what we now call Parliament Square, John’s Coffee House once buzzed with the energy of Edinburgh’s legal and intellectual elite. But behind the cobblestones and grand facades lies a history thick with intrigue, secrets, and, some say, restless spirits. Tonight, we’re stepping back to 1688, into the smoky, crowded rooms where lawyers, merchants, and thinkers gathered over coffee, wine, and brandy—and where whispers of political plotting, deals, and even darker events might still echo. For anyone searching for haunted sites in Edinburgh or paranormal activity near the Royal Mile, John’s Coffee House is a story you won’t want to miss.


    This wasn’t just a coffee house—it was a stage for ambition, rivalry, and sometimes disaster. From secretive meetings of creditors to fiery debates over the 1707 Act of Union, the people who passed through John’s were shaping the city’s—and the nation’s—future. But along with the great minds came the human flaws: heavy drinking, brawls, and a few shadowy incidents that were quietly recorded in gossip and legal notes.

    In this episode of the True Hauntings podcast we’re digging into every layer of John’s story: the daily “meridian” brandy rituals of the lawyers, the infamous “Cauld Cock and Feather” drink, the political plotting and late-night arguments, and the sudden destruction of the Great Fire of 1824 that buried the building—and possibly disturbed graves beneath its floors. 

    And we’ll explore the eerie aftermath: the Police Chambers that rose on the same site, ghostly encounters reported during renovations, and the modern revival of John’s Coffee House that leans into its dark past.
